Output 57172926298b9089deb73fd616df30c403f6a1c0138a6a8405f672f6c3445981:1

value
312107545
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4815720ac2e25a69c27a93eec1678c3fcf314df2 OP_EQUALVERIFY OP_CHECKSIG
address
17a9LsST3TuaYpR4GUq9nv5QkFka972ppD
transaction
57172926298b9089deb73fd616df30c403f6a1c0138a6a8405f672f6c3445981
spent
true